Project Communications Manager - job post
Location
Full job description
We are seeking an exceptional Project Communications Manager to work on a contractor basis, leading all communications across a significant building works programme at Paragon Works' client partners, Schroders' Head Office.
Hours: 4 days per week and ad-hoc hours for the ongoing project
Salary: £600 - £800 per day
As the Project Communications Manager, you will shape, deliver and oversee internal and external messaging, keeping employees, stakeholders and our reputation front of mind. As the dedicated communications expert, you’ll develop integrated, transparent and engaging messages for all affected audiences, protecting our reputation and ensuring everyone stays informed and reassured.
You’ll act as a trusted adviser to senior leaders, coordinate cross-functional input, and take ownership of day-to-day, strategic and reactive comms across multiple channels. This is an exceptional opportunity to apply your communications expertise to a unique, high-profile project, where you can make a genuine difference for our people, stakeholders and business.
Reporting to Head of Planning, Comms and Marketing, you’ll collaborate with senior projecowners, facilities, risk, legal and central comms teams, as well as external partners and advisers. You’ll be the primary point of contact for all programme communications, working closely with internal and corporate comms to ensure alignment.
What you’ll do
- Create, lead and deliver a joined-up communications strategy for the programme, reflecting Schroders’ brand, values and regulatory priorities. You will be the sole, go-to person for all programme Comms.
- Provide timely and effective briefings to senior leadership and other stakeholders, ensuring they are fully informed on key communications initiatives, reputational issues and strategic messaging opportunities.
- Craft compelling, audience-specific content across multiple channels aligned with the Internal Comms tone of voice and existing comprehensive comms calendar.
- Provide comms input with additional written requirements of the programme, such as planning applications or necessary statements.
- Client and employee experience are critical, so you’ll develop and oversee an approach to meet their needs at every stage of the programme.
- Work closely with Marketing and preferred suppliers to manage all required brand assets throughout.
- Drive open, timely engagement, ensuring voices are heard and audiences are kept fully informed.
- Manage and de-escalate crises, particularly in relation to reputation, providing confident, solutions-focused messaging and coordination.
- Advise and influence senior executives and cross-functional teams.
- Champion best practice and continuous improvement, setting new standards for project communications.
- Leverage latest technology and AI, keeping our comms modern, innovative, and effective.
- Document and uphold all processes, maintaining rigorous records.
Required Experience and skills:
- Extensive communications experience in complex or regulated environments
- Exceptional written and verbal communication skills, able to distil and convey complex information
- High-level organisational and planning skills, with ownership and accountability from start to finish
- Proven expertise in crisis response and reputation management
- Analytical and insight-driven; confident using metrics to refine strategy
- Ability to build trust and credibility with senior stakeholders, technical teams and contractors
- Passion for innovative, tech and AI-enabled communications solutions
What we are looking for in you:
- Approachable, collaborative and builds strong relationships at every level
- Exceptionally detail-oriented and organised, with robust processes and record keeping
- Energised by solving complex communications challenges and providing expert guidance to others
- Calm under pressure and adept at managing sensitive issues
- Self-motivated, with a focus on achieving results and continuous improvement
- Someone who sees the things other miss and addresses them in a deliberate and determined way.
